Websites hosted on 152.228.227.60 IP address

1 websites

IP address 152.228.227.60 is registered for France. The server carries IP 152.228.227.60 located at latitude 50.6937 and longitude 3.17444, time zone is GMT +1. Server location in Hauts-de-France, Roubaix, France, zipcode 59689.

1.Maud.fr

maud.fr Rank:6,728,273 Worth:$11

Maquillage Permanent : Sourcils, Yeux, Lèvres osez l'excellence des techniques MAUD Maquillage Permanent prêtes à sublimer la beauté de vos Yeux, Soucils

Let's share 💋💋💋